Steps to Convert Feet to Yards
Converting feet to yards is straightforward once you grasp the basic relationship between the two units. Here's a step-by-step breakdown:
Step 1: Remember the Basic Conversion Factor
The foundation of this conversion lies in the fact that 1 yard = 3 feet. This ratio is critical for all calculations involving these units That's the whole idea..
Step 2: Apply Division to Convert Feet to Yards
To find out how many yards are in 17 feet, divide 17 by 3:
17 ÷ 3 = 5.666...
This means 17 feet is equivalent to 5 full yards and a fractional remainder.
Step 3: Understand the Remainder
Since 3 × 5 = 15, the remaining 2 feet (17 - 15 = 2) must be converted into yards. Dividing 2 by 3 gives 0.666... yards, which can be expressed as a fraction (2/3) or a decimal.

Scientific Explanation of the Imperial System
The imperial system, which includes feet and yards, has historical roots tracing back to ancient civilizations. The foot was originally based on the length of a human foot, while the yard was defined as the distance from the tip of the nose to the thumb of an outstretched arm. These informal definitions evolved over time, leading to standardized measurements in the 13th century Easy to understand, harder to ignore..
Today, the yard is legally defined as 0.9144 meters in the United States and other countries using the imperial system. This standardization ensures consistency in conversions. As an example, 17 feet equals 5.1816 meters, which aligns with the yard conversion when considering the metric equivalent.

Frequently Asked Questions (FAQ)
Q: What is the exact value of 17 feet in yards?
A: The exact value is 5 and 2/3 yards or 5.666... yards. This fraction represents the precise relationship without rounding.
Q: How do I convert yards back to feet?
A: Multiply the number of yards by 3. As an example, 5.67 yards × 3 = 17.01 feet, which is close to the original 17 feet.
Q: Why isn't the conversion a whole number?
A: Because 17 is not evenly divisible by 3. This results in a fractional or decimal value, which is common when converting between units of different sizes The details matter here..
